We settle the problem of the uniqueness of normalized homeomorphic solutions
to nonlinear Beltrami equations $\bar\partial f(z)=H(z, \partial f(z))$. It
turns out that the uniqueness holds under definite and explicit bounds on the
ellipticity at infinity, but not in general.
